KindNest Support was founded on a simple belief — that every person deserves support that is both clinically excellent and genuinely human.
Founded and led by a Registered Nurse and Psychologist
KindNest Support was established by a team with deep roots in healthcare — a Registered Nurse and a Psychologist who saw firsthand the gap between what NDIS participants needed and what was available to them.
We built KindNest to fill that gap. Our clinical backgrounds mean we understand disability, ageing, and devolopment care needs at a level most support providers simply cannot match. We bring that expertise to every interaction — not just in the services we deliver, but in how we listen, plan, and advocate for the people in our care.
Based in North-West Sydney, we support children, adults, and older persons across the community — always with the same commitment to dignity, safety, and genuine connection.
